Re: going to mountain forts
« Reply #4 on: February 12, 2010, 06:31:31 am »

You can travel from a mountain to a normal travelable area.
But you cant travel from something to a mountain tile.
Get it?

So you have to go on foot... enjoy your 20 hour crossing...
